    About UMass Amherst

     

    The flagship of the Commonwealth, the University of Massachusetts Amherst is a nationally ranked public land-grant research university that seeks to expand educational access, fuel innovation and creativity, and share and use its knowledge for the common good. Founded in 1863, UMass Amherst sits on nearly 1,450-acres in scenic Western Massachusetts and boasts state-of-the-art facilities for teaching, research, scholarship, and creative activity. The institution advances a diverse, equitable, and inclusive community where everyone feels connected and valued—and thrives, and offers a full range of undergraduate, graduate and professional degrees across 10 schools and colleges, and 100 undergraduate majors.     Job Summary

    Reporting to the Assistant Vice Chancellor for Strategic Outreach & Engagement, and an integral part of a dynamic team, the OEI Engagement Coordinator coordinates all programs and initiatives under the engagement branch of the Office of Equity & Inclusion (OEI). This position handles all aspects of planning and logistics for high-profile OEI events, programs, and initiatives in the interest of enhancing the universities responsiveness to inclusion needs on campus.

    Essential Functions

    + Manage planning and coordination of events, programs, and engagement initiatives led by the Office of Equity & Inclusion.

    + Support the Assistant Vice Chancellor through project management efforts, contributing to the advancement of special initiatives and collaborative projects, as well as oversight and support of Graduate Assistant tasks and objectives.

    + Oversee the grant application process for all OEI grant initiatives, including Engagement Fund Grants, Campus Climate Improvement Grants, and Advancing Community Democracy and Dialogue Grants.

    + Contribute to the implementation of innovative co-curricular programs and initiatives to sustain and/or increase engagement and community building for the UMass community.

    + Gather information and provide appropriately synthesized information and reports.

    + Communicate with cross‐campus parties, developing and monitoring plans.

    + Establish and maintain relationships with both internal and external campus partners.

    + Maintain contemporary knowledge of current trends and participate in related training to stay abreast of new developments in the field and apply new knowledge as appropriate.

     

    Other Functions

     

    + Perform related duties as assigned or required to meet Department, Executive Area/Division, and University goals and objectives.

     

    Minimum Qualifications (Knowledge, Skills, Abilities, Education, Experience, Certifications, Licensure)

     

    + Bachelor’s degree with one (1) year of experience in project or event management.

    + Excellent time management and organizational skills with the ability to independently prioritize and work on several projects simultaneously.

    + Strong written and verbal communication skills and experience serving a large, culturally diverse population.

    + Demonstrated commitment to equity, diversity, inclusion, accessibility, and justice.

     

    Preferred Qualifications (Knowledge, Skills, Abilities, Education, Experience, Certifications, Licensure)

     

    + Prior experience in engagement, DEI, and/or programming in higher education.

    + Experience in developing strategies to increase program creation and engagement.

     

    Physical Demands/Working Conditions

     

    + Typical office environment.

     

    Work Schedule

     

    + Monday – Friday, 9:00 am - 5:00 pm (37.5 hours per week).

    + Required to work some nights and weekends.

    + This position has the opportunity for a hybrid work schedule, which is defined by the University as an arrangement where an employee’s work is regularly performed at a location other than the campus workspace for a portion of the week. As this position falls within the Professional Staff Union, it is subject to the terms and conditions of the Professional Staff Union collective bargaining agreement.
